Damaged pipeline joints


Pipeline joints are the parts of our plumbing system where the pipes link. They are the weakest point of our plumbing system. As a result, they are extra at risk to deterioration. It is important to keep in mind that despite the fact that pipelines are designed to hold up against stress and last for a while, they weren't developed to last permanently; as a result, they would certainly degrade with time. This damage can cause fractures in plumbing systems. A common sign of harmed pipeline joints is extreme noise from faucets.

High water pressure


You saw your home water stress is higher than normal but then, why should you care? It's out of your control.
It would be best if you cared since your typical water stress should be 60 Psi (per square inch) and although your home's plumbing system is created to withstand 80 Psi. An increase in water pressure can put a stress on your house pipelines as well as lead to cracks, or worse, ruptured pipelines. Get in touch with an expert regarding controling it if you ever before discover that your house water stress is greater than usual.

Corrosion


As your pipework gets older, it gets weak as well as more at risk to rust after the frequent passage of water via them, which can eat away at pipelines as well as create cracks. A noticeable sign of rust in your house plumbing system is discoloration as well as although this could be hard to find due to a lot of pipelines hidden away. Once they are old to guarantee an audio plumbing system, we encourage doing a constant check-up every couple of years and also transform pipelines

Blocked drains pipes


Food bits, dust, as well as grease can cause clogged drains pipes and also block the passage of water in and out of your sink. If undealt with, increased pressure within the rain gutters can create an overflow and end up splitting or rupturing pipes. To avoid stopped up drains pipes in your home, we advise you to prevent pouring fragments down the tubes and also routine cleaning of sinks.

Broken seals


An additional source of water leaks in houses is broken seals of home devices that make use of water, e.g., a dishwasher. When such home appliances are installed, seals are set up around water ports for very easy passage of water with the machine. Therefore, a busted seal can trigger leakage of water when in use.

How to detect water leaks in the household?


The best way to check for any dripping or leakages in your drainage system is to check the usage of water during the colder months regularly. There may be a possible leakage in the piping system if a family comprising of four families has their water bills for 12,000 gallons a month.



Next check your water meter in-between hours when kitchen and bathrooms are not being used. If there are ups and downs in your meter’s reading then you might be facing some water leaking problems.



A quick way to check for leakages in the toilets is to drop some food colours in the toilet tank. If the colour appears on the commote in 10 mins before the flush is used, then there’s a leak. After the 10 mins flush the toilet to avoid stains in the tank.
